Q: Is 26,822,158 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 26,822,158 is a composite number.

Why is 26,822,158 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 26,822,158 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 17 22 29 34 58 187 319 374 493 638 986 2,473 4,946 5,423 10,846 27,203 42,041 54,406 71,717 84,082 143,434 462,451 788,887 924,902 1,219,189 1,577,774 2,438,378 13,411,079 and 26,822,158, with no remainder.

Since 26,822,158 cannot be divided by just 1 and 26,822,158, it is a composite number.
